New Ant-Man images appear online

A new batch of Ant-Man images have appeared online, giving us a closer look at Paul Rudd as Scott Lang, both in and out of the suit.

Alongside the new images, EW has been speaking to Paul Rudd, who says that despite his receiving a credit on the final script, it remains very close to the version Edgar Wright and Joe Cornish put together.

"The bones of it is really Edgar and Joe," says Rudd. "It’s been an emotional roller coaster, but I’m very excited now."

The report also uncovers a couple of additional plot details, revealing that the film begins with Lang in prison for robbing a crooked CEO of a major company.

Upon leaving prison, he runs across Michael Douglas's Hank Pym and steals his Ant-Man suit, before the fun really begins…

Directed by Peyton Reed and co-starring Corey Stoll, Evangeline Lilly and Michael Peña, Ant-Man will open in the UK and US on 17 July 2015.

Disney have also released three further images, including a piece of concept art of Ant-Man almost being washed down a plughole. Hopefully he'll have a Cheerio/Polo mint/Lifesaver for buoyancy...
